Ok, it's 9.95 a month, for 4 characters. Which is enough to have one character of each class.

The Graphics are eh...? Well, they're 2D, I think it's nice. They're very Animeish.

It's set in Ancient Korea, with a Mythical Touch.

Uh Gosh it was created in like 90's like 96. It's been around forever. People still play that have been there since beta. It works well for people on Dial-Up or better. Pretty much all of the bugs are worked out, and now they concentrate on events and new weapons/armor type stuff.

Now the type is up to you. You can spend all days hacking and slashing away at monsters, or you can get to around level 99, join a subpath, and role-play until you're very content. All kinds of people play the game. There are lots of things to do, like try to become rich, have the coolest stuff, participate in Player vs Player wars called Carnages. It just depends on what you want. *Shrugs* Try it for free 10 days, it's only a 50 MB download for you Broadband users. Check it out, talk to people, I'll be around and hopefully have my debit card soon so I can register.

Any other questions?

Oh yeah, your growth in power, it's unlimited. You can keep increasing your vitality and mana all you want.
